Restaurant Summary
Set on Rowena in Silver Lake, Michelangelo feels like a warm neighborhood Italian where hosts greet you by name and the patio hums with relaxed chatter. One diner put it simply: "Service was sweet and accommodating, and the food came out hot." The room reads cozy and welcoming rather than fancy, with staff who check in often and keep things comfortable. In the kitchen, the approach leans classic and comforting: fresh pastas, well-topped pizzas, and staples like eggplant parm and seafood risotto. Guests praise the hearty portions and straightforward flavors over culinary theatrics, and specials like a Valentine tasting menu pop up seasonally. Most visits land as satisfying and reliable, though seafood execution can vary and the occasional missed topping or bland plate appears in a minority of reports. Families fit right in. Kids gravitate to simple pizzas and plain pastas, and a parent noted their child loved a small ice cream sundae. Vegetarians and vegans have real options, from meatless lasagna to customizable pastas and veggie pizzas, making this an easy pick for mixed-diet groups.
